State Leadership in Clean Energy: Award-Winning Programs in New Hampshire and Rhode Island

Date: 7/13/2016

Source: Clean Energy States Alliance

1 p.m. ET Clean Energy States Alliance (CESA) is hosting a webinar that will highlight two winning programs from CESA's 2016 State Leadership in Clean Energy Awards: New Hampshire's Useful Thermal Energy Certificate (T-REC) Program and Rhode Island's System Reliability Procurement Solar Distributed Generation Pilot Project.

New Hampshire's T-REC program is a key component of the most comprehensive initiative to support renewable thermal technologies in the country. It has provided significant economic and environmental benefits for the state and is having a substantial influence on renewable thermal policy in other states.

Rhode Island's distributed solar pilot project explored how distributed PV could provide value for the electric grid. It successfully mobilized the local community to adopt solar PV, exceeded goals for solar deployment, helped to defer traditional utility capital investments, and provided important lessons for the consideration of "non-wires alternatives" in distribution system planning.
